    This was an amazing place to visit! The springs are in the middle of a national forest on the banks of the Au Sable River, so the views are gorgeous. There are 300 stairs to go down, so be cautious…you have to climb back up them! But it is well worth the effort. It was not crowded when I went and the weather was perfect, so it was very peaceful and calming. There are a few small waterfalls as you go down, and boardwalks to walk along when you reach the bottom. You won’t be sorry you came!

    Really quick...I'm from New England. This beach is better than 99% of what the Northeast has. The sand is perfect. The water of Huron is clear and there is plenty of room to spread out here with friends, family, have a picnic, hang out at the accompanying park (they are also building a Hotel within a stone's throw that should be complete by 2024). There is a bathhouse, rest room, a snack and drink vendor and a cute little coffee shop, Oscodo Museum and vintage movie theatre with a couple blocks as well. It's pretty easy to spend the whole afternoon here. Highly recommended beach that rivalled anything on Mackinac Island. Possibly the best beach on Michigan's east coast as a lot of these pictures don't do it justice.
